摘要
由自蔓延高温合成技术制取的材料普遍具有孔隙率大的特点,而把SHS工艺和熔融金属渗入技术结合可以制得致密度高的复合材料。复合材料性能测试结果表明:硬度提高了44HB.相对耐磨性提高了82%。
The material made from self-propagating high temperature synthesis technique has a lot of cavities.The combination of SHS and molten metal infiltration can produce composite material of high densification.The effect of property test on the composite material is that the hardness increases 44HB,ε increases by 86%.
